Pakistan's Zardari wants to save coalition with PML-N

Thu, May 15 03:05 PM

Islamabad, May 15 (ANI): The leader of the main party in Pakistan's fractured six-week-old coalition government, Asif Ali Zardari, in his first public comments on the split in the coalition, on Wednesday said he hoped the party which has resigned from the cabinet this week would remain a partner. Former Prime Minister Nawaz Sharif, has promised that his party would support the government.
